In the dystopian world of 2021, Johnny, a data courier, holds sensitive information implanted in his brain. The data’s overload threatens his life, forcing him to escape assassins and extract the data before it kills him. This high-stakes scenario unfolds amidst a backdrop of corporate domination and cybernetic alterations, culminating in a vivid confrontation with varied forces seeking the data he carries.

Trivia
- Originally envisioned as a low-budget art film, it expanded into a major production due to funding dynamics.
- Val Kilmer was initially cast in the lead role but was replaced by Keanu Reeves due to scheduling conflicts.
- The film features a dolphin character, Jones, that aids in data decryption.

Despite its cult status among cyberpunk enthusiasts, “Johnny Mnemonic” balances its ambitious technological themes with a mix of stellar and uneven performances. The plot’s complexity and the unique setting are notable, though the film occasionally struggles with pacing and clarity, reflecting its tumultuous production history.
